Eligibility by age and weight

  • Flag - Ages 5-6-7* - No weight restrictions
  • Mitey Mites - Ages 7-8-9* - Weight 45-90 pounds
  • Jr. Pee Wee - Ages 8-9-10* - Weight 60-105 pounds
  • Jr. Pee Wee Older / Lighter - Age 11* - Weight 60-85 pounds
  • Pee Wee - Ages 9-10-11* - Weight 75-120 pounds
  • Pee Wee Older / Lighter - Age 12* - Weight 70-100 pounds
    Maximum Roster is 35 (except for flag which is 24)
    *Age of your child as of July 31, 2011

Cheerleading

Cheerleading squads are also offered for boys and girls ages 5-13. The age of your child will determine what team they will cheer with (there are no weight requirements). All other requirements are the same as football players. Practice schedule will be given out by the coaches. Along with games, the cheer squad also goes to competitions throughout the state.

Practices

Practices will begin on the first Monday of August 2011. Practice days and times will be determined by the coaching staff. The number of practices per week ranges from 3-5 and time length from 2-2½ hours. Once school begins, the number of practices will be reduced. The locations of practices are the Chatham Fairgrounds and the Ghent Town Park. Parents are urged to stay at practice in case of foul weather (heat, lightning, extreme cold, snow, or rain).

Games

Regular season games begin in September. All teams play 8 regular season games except for Flag plays which plays 6 games. All home games will be played at Chatham High School. Games may be scheduled for Saturday or Sunday. The regular season normally concludes in late October; however, should teams perform well, there are additional playoff games that may extend the season.
